    About Oakland Promise:

    Oakland Promise supports young learners (from newborns to college students) and their families who reside in Oakland. OP offers every child financial resources, educational programming, mentorship, and a supportive community to help them and their families thrive in higher education and the career of their choosing. Our mission is to engage the Oakland community to advance equity and economic mobility through cradle-to-college-and-career achievement. Oakland Promise leads key programming including, Brilliant Baby, K–12 services, College & Career work, East Oakland Promise Neighborhood initiative and now Wealth Builds Oakland; together, they are designed to remove structural barriers and foster intergenerational social and economic mobility.

    About the Wealth Builds Oakland program:

    Wealth Builds Oakland (WBO) is a high-priority initiative designed to increase economic mobility for Oakland families by providing tools, resources, and opportunities to grow generational wealth. The program focuses on building financial capability, supporting savings and investment strategies, and partnering with local and national institutions to expand access to economic opportunity. WBO works in partnership with the National Wealth Builds Partner to ensure alignment with national standards and practices, while tailoring implementation to meet the unique needs of Oakland communities.

    About the Role:

    Oakland Promise seeks a Director of Wealth Builds Oakland to lead the design, implementation, and scaling of the Wealth Builds initiative. This leader will serve as the strategic and operational driver for the program, coordinating partnerships, managing financial and impact tracking systems, and ensuring strong collaboration across OP departments and with the National partner. This is an exciting opportunity for a motivated, entrepreneurial, and detail-oriented professional who is passionate about building pathways to social and economic mobility. This position is full-time, hybrid, and requires residence within commuting distance to Oakland.
